I. Basic Characteristics of C84400 Recyclable Bronze and S32760 Stainless Steel
(1) C84400 Recyclable Bronze
C84400 is a lead bronze, which belongs to copper-based alloys. It has good corrosion resistance, wear resistance, and thermal conductivity. Its chemical composition mainly includes copper (78.0% - 82.0%), zinc (7.0% - 10.0%), tin (2.3% - 3.5%), and lead (6.0% - 8.0%). The mechanical properties of this material are also quite excellent. Its tensile strength can reach 207 MPa, yield strength is 103 MPa, and elongation is 16%.
(2) S32760 Stainless Steel
S32760 is a super duplex stainless steel. Its chemical composition has been optimized and contains high chromium (24% - 26%), molybdenum (3% - 4%), nitrogen (0.20% - 0.30%), and a small amount of tungsten (0.5% - 1.0%). The tensile strength of this material is as high as 790 - 930 MPa, yield strength is 550 - 750 MPa, and elongation is 20% - 25%. Its duplex structure (austenite and ferrite) endows it with excellent corrosion resistance and high strength.
II. Comparison of Environmental Ratings between C84400 Recyclable Bronze and S32760 Stainless Steel
Items | C84400 Recyclable Bronze | S32760 Stainless Steel |
Main Components | Copper, Zinc, Tin, Lead | Chromium, Nickel, Molybdenum, Nitrogen, Tungsten, Copper |
Recyclability | High. The main component copper can be completely recycled. | Medium. Stainless steel can also be recycled, but the recovery rate is lower than that of copper. |
Corrosion Resistance | Good, but has poor tolerance to certain acidic environments. | Excellent, especially performs well in chloride and acidic environments. |
Service Life | Medium, depending on the application environment. | Long, especially in corrosive environments. |
Hazardous Substances | Contains lead, but is exempted by RoHS in some applications. | No hazardous substances, meets the requirements of RoHS. |
Comprehensive Environmental Rating | B (High recyclability, but the presence of lead limits its environmental friendliness.) | A (Strong corrosion resistance, no hazardous substances, long service life.) |
III. Conclusions and Recommendations
Under the trend of green manufacturing, S32760 stainless steel is superior to C84400 RECYCLABLE BRONZE in terms of environmental rating due to its excellent corrosion resistance, absence of hazardous substances, and longer service life. However, the high recyclability of C84400 BRONZE and its exemption in specific applications also give it certain advantages in some fields. When enterprises choose filter materials, they should make a trade-off according to the specific application environment and environmental protection requirements. If the application environment has extremely high requirements for corrosion resistance and needs to comply with strict environmental regulations, S32760 stainless steel is a better choice. While in some areas that are cost-sensitive and have no strict restrictions on lead content, C84400 recyclable bronze can also be a viable option.
